The World Food Program of the United Nations in Afghanistan has announced that it needs 718 million dollars for its continued activities in the next six months.

This organization wrote in a newsletter on its user account today that a large number of Afghan citizens are facing difficulties in meeting their food needs.

According to the World Food Program of the United Nations, the process of distributing winter aid to more than six million Afghan citizens has begun.
